Tottenham begin chase for Hart

Tottenham begin chase for Hart

14 May 2008 - 16:12

Tottenham have begun their chase for a new goalkeeper this summer as they appear to be set to offer Manchester City Paul Robinson as bait in their hunt to land talented England shot stopper Joe Hart.

  • Man City are known to be disappointed with the interest in Tottenham as they hope to keep the player at the club for the forseeable future.



    The deal is believed to be a cash plus player move, and Tottenham are ready to offer around £5 million plus Robinson in their attempts to land the keeper.



    The former Shrewsbury keeper only joined Man City for £600k in 2006, but his fee looks to have sky-rocketed as big clubs move in for the player.
